Career
In association football, he played the wing half position for the clubs Vålerengen and Larvik Turn. He represented the clubs Stranden Illinois and Vikersund IF in skiing. He represented Larvik Turn in athletics as well.
He also competed in team handball, bandy, gymnastics, swimming and dogsled racing.
He was awarded the prize for versatility,, in 1950. He died in 1954, only 33 years old, after a long-term illness.
